About This Home
Welcome to this spacious and well-maintained 1-story residence located in the heart of Coral Springs! This 4-bedroom,2.5-bathroom home with a 2-car garage offers an ideal layout for both comfortable living and entertaining. Roof 2015. Ac 2020. Garage Door 2019 Step inside to find generous living areas filled with natural light and a functional split-bedroom floor plan. The primary suite is a true retreat featuring oversized walk-in closets and a large ensuite bath with dual vanities and separate his-and-hers sinks. The outdoor space is a standout feature -- enjoy a beautifully designed backyard with a sparkling pool and wood terrace,perfect for relaxing evenings,weekend gatherings,and year-round Florida living. Major updates provide peace of mind,including a new roof (2015),A/C system (2020),garage door (2019),water heater,and pool pump. All windows are equipped with hurricane shutters for added protection and insurance savings. Situated in a fantastic neighborhood within a highly desirable school zone and close to parks,shopping,dining,and major roadways,this home presents an excellent opportunity to own in one of Coral Springs' most sought-after areas. Large lots and lush landscaping with many area parks draw locals to Cypress Run, a few miles southwest of downtown Coral Springs. Many of the houses for rent hail from the 1980s, when the neighborhood developed. Waterway canals weave through the neighborhood, running behind many of the single-family homes in the area.
Cypress Park serves residents with multiple sports fields and courts, a two-story clubhouse, playground, and paved exercise pathway. Just across the street, the Cypress Hammock Park and Cypress Orchid Park offer more green space, tennis courts, and a swimming pool with slides. The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
